axios跨域请求设置cookies

阅读数:166 评论数:0

跳转到新版页面

分类

html/css/js

正文

1、(前端)跨域请求是携带Cookie ,需要配置axios.defaults.withCredentials = true;
2、(后端)响应需要携带响应头 Access-Control-Allow-Credentials: true;
3、(后端)响应头 Access-Control-Allow-Origin 不能是通配符“*” ,并且需要和请求头Origin 的值一致




相关推荐

一、简介 js-cookie和vue-cookies都是vue中的插件,可用来操作cookie,当然也可以用原生来获取cookie。 二、使用js-cookie 根据官网描述其优点有:适用所有浏览器、

在我们封装请求的js文件中加一个判断即可,先声明一个变量showMsg来控制是否需要弹框,初始化为true,然后在请求判断中如果token失效导致走了401,先判断当前是否可以显示弹框,初始化为

一、使用vue-cli新建工程 vue create demo1 然后用vsco

一、使用pnpm新建项目 可以使用npm 或yarn或pnpm来初始化Vite项目 pnpm create vite xxx(项目名称) #选择vue #选择js cd xxx (进入项目目录) #安

一、概述 NUXT 是一个基于 Vue.js 的轻量级应用框架,可用来创建服务端渲染(SSR)应用,也可充当静态站点引擎生成静态站点应用。服务端渲染又称 SSR (Server Side Render